Party City Creates New Social Applications for Halloween Shoppers

Party City has launched several new online social applications to improve the customer experience for Halloween, tying these applications into popular sites like YouTube, Facebook, and Twitter.

 

Rockaway, NJ -- (SBWIRE) -- 09/22/2010 -- Party City, America's largest Halloween costume and party supplies retailer, has launched several new or improved online social applications to jump start the Halloween season and improve the customer experience.

Tying into popular social sites like YouTube, Facebook, and Twitter, and in some cases employing sophisticated interactive technology, these applications are designed to reward, educate, and engage Halloween enthusiasts and even guide them through the process of choosing the right costume for their budget and taste. Popular applications include:

- Digital Dressing Room ( http://www.partycity.com/dressingroom.do ): Upload your photo and "try on" hundreds of Halloween costumes and accessories in a virtual dressing room. Save customized costumes for later or share them with friends via Facebook and Twitter.

- Brew Your Costume 2.0 ( http://brewyourcostume.com/ ): The all-knowing cauldron analyzes a user's Facebook profile and asks questions to assess personality and assemble the right ingredients for a perfectly concocted Halloween costume. Brew Your Costume 2.0 boasts a more robust engine and enhanced graphic presentation.

- 2010 Halloween Fashion Show ( http://www.youtube.com/user/partycity ): Vampires, Greek goddesses and material girls take to the catwalk on YouTube as Party City unveils the 2010 hottest Halloween trends.

- Party-A-Day-Giveaway ( http://promo3.cfapromo.com/partyaday/ ): Join the Party Club for free to be entered into a $10,000 Grand Prize drawing and the daily $100 Party-A-Day Giveaway.

House of Halloweenies ( http://houseofhalloweenies.com/ ): An online Halloween experience, the House of Halloweenies features animated hot dog characters and allows visitors to explore a haunted house for hidden tricks and treats.

According to the National Retail Federation, in 2009 consumers spent a total of $1.75 billion nationally on Halloween costumes, attesting to the surging popularity of Halloween. In response to the ever-increasing demand for Halloween costumes, Party City has intensified its digital dedication and expanded its social presence to provide Party City customers with engaging and playful social applications to browse and shop for Halloween costumes and accessories.

About Party City
Party City Corporation is America's largest party goods chain and Halloween retailer, operating more than 600 stores throughout the United States and Puerto Rico. As a part of the Amscan Holdings, Inc., Party City is among the more than 900 specialty party stores that AHI either owns, operates, or franchises.
